Why Timberwood Park’s Climate & Housing Affect Garage Door

Timberwood Park occupies a specific ecological niche that shapes every garage door system in ways homeowners rarely notice until something fails. The community sits in the Bexar County Hill Country transition zone, where summer highs routinely push past 100°F and winter can deliver hard freezes severe enough to snap springs already fatigued by decades of thermal cycling. The February 2021 freeze seized openers across this corridor whose lubrication had never been cold-weather checked.

The defining local factor, though, is the cedar. Timberwood Park sits squarely in the Hill Country cedar belt, and the annual pollen season from December through February deposits a yellow-green film at concentrations that dwarf urban San Antonio neighborhoods just 10-15 miles south. This pollen coats photo-eye sensor lenses, fills track grooves, and cakes weatherstripping. A door that “stops mid-travel for no reason” during these months is almost always a pollen-blinded sensor, not a wiring fault or logic-board failure. Local technicians know to check this first; out-of-area crews often misdiagnose and replace unnecessary parts.

The housing stock reinforces these patterns. Most Timberwood Park homes were built between the late 1970s and mid-1990s as custom or semi-custom single-family residences on large, wooded lots. The two- to three-car garages were sized for semi-rural use - boats, ATVs, horse trailers - and fitted with torsion springs, cables, and openers from that era. Those original components are now reaching end-of-life simultaneously, which is why full-system replacements outnumber simple repairs on our Timberwood Park calls.

The deed-restricted nature of the community adds another layer. Timberwood Park’s HOA architectural guidelines require that garage door replacements conform to approved styles and colors, an approval step that doesn’t exist in nearby unincorporated communities. We help homeowners navigate this process, submitting specifications to the architectural committee before ordering to avoid costly mistakes.

Pricing for Garage Door in Timberwood Park

We quote every job flat, before any work begins. The price on the invoice matches the price you approved. No surprises, no escalation once we’re in your garage.

Service Typical Range in Timberwood Park
Spring repair (single torsion) $180 - $260
Spring repair (dual torsion / high-cycle) $280 - $340
Cable replacement (pair) $140 - $200
Opener repair (gear, sensor, limit switch) $120 - $220
New opener installation (standard belt/chain) $450 - $750
Full door replacement (standard steel, installed) $1,200 - $2,400
Seasonal tune-up $89 (standing offer)

These ranges reflect Timberwood Park’s market and the typical door configurations we encounter. An exact quote requires a brief look at your door’s size, weight, and condition. Estimates are free, and our $50-off repair-over-$250 offer applies automatically.
